The Scenario
You are a portfolio director at a consulting firm. You oversee five client Motion workspaces. The managing partner asked for a governance report before the quarterly partners meeting — workspace names, types, available statuses, configured labels, all five workspaces, one Excel workbook.
You have admin access. You have never had to produce this before. The partners meeting is Thursday. Today is Tuesday.
You open Motion and realize that the configuration details you need are spread across five separate Settings panels, each with their own status and label lists.
The bad version:
- Open Workspace 1. Settings. Find statuses. Copy them into a workbook cell.
- Open Workspace 2. Settings. Realize the statuses are in a different menu location — this workspace was set up by a different admin.
- Copy statuses. Then labels. Then switch to Workspace 3.
- By Workspace 4 you have three workbooks open, inconsistent column formatting, and are genuinely unsure whether you captured labels for Workspace 2.
The governance report is due in 36 hours. Manual settings archaeology across five Motion workspaces is not how they will be spent.
The Easy Way: One Prompt in SheetXAI
SheetXAI is an AI agent that lives inside your Excel workbook. It reads Motion's workspace configurations and structures the data into a clean worksheet. Open the sidebar and ask.
Fetch all workspaces from Motion and for each list the workspace name, team name, and all configured status values — write into one row per workspace.
What You Get
- One row per workspace with workspace name, team name, and all configured statuses.
- Consistent formatting across all five workspaces — no Settings panel navigation.
- Ready to paste into the governance report or extend with a labels column.
What If the Data Is Not Quite Ready
You need both statuses and labels in the inventory
The partners report calls for labels alongside statuses.
List all Motion workspaces I have access to and write each workspace name, ID, type, and available status labels to this sheet — one row per workspace.
You want one row per status for easier filtering
The compliance team wants to filter by status name across workspaces.
Fetch all Motion workspaces and write one row per status value, including the workspace name, workspace ID, and the status name — one row per status, not one row per workspace.
You need to flag status inconsistencies across workspaces
Two workspaces might call the same stage different things — the governance team wants to see where that happens.
Fetch all Motion workspaces and write workspace name and status values to Sheet1. In Sheet2, list every unique status name across all workspaces and flag any status that does not appear in all five workspaces as INCONSISTENT.
Full governance report in one pass — workspaces, statuses, labels, inconsistencies, and a summary count
The partners want the full picture in one workbook.
Fetch all Motion workspaces. Write workspace name, type, configured statuses, and configured labels to the Detail worksheet — one row per workspace. In the Inconsistencies worksheet, flag any status or label name that does not appear in every workspace. In the Summary worksheet, write one row per workspace showing workspace name, total status count, and total label count.
One prompt builds the governance document your partners asked for.
Try It
Open your governance workbook or a blank Excel file, then Get the 7-day free trial of SheetXAI and ask it to export a complete inventory of your Motion workspaces. For related workflows, see how to export Motion workspace users or export recurring tasks for a workload audit.
